Solution

The correct option is B Salivary gland

Intrinsic glands are the glands that are present in the alimentary canal and extrinsic glands are those present outside the alimentary canal. The only intrinsic gland mentioned in the answer options are salivary glands. Other intrinsic glands include pyloric glands in the stomach and the glands of the small intestine etc. Liver, pancreas etc form a part of the extrinsic glands of the digestive system. The Gall bladder however, is not a gland but a storage organ for bile.
